Talos
The Kneeling Talos statue was modeled from the Talos character in the hit 60's film, Jason and the Argonauts. Featuring the talent of Ray Harryhausen's stop-film animation, the Talos is awoken when a few greedy sailors attempt to steal the treasures of the gods that he is guarding. In this infamously scary scene, his head slowly turns in the direction of the thieves.
The Kneeling Talos statue, available through Monstersdirect.com, is approximately 12" tall. It is sculpted in of cold-cast resin and highly detailed. The Talos can be removed from the base, but it is designed to be mounted in the way it is pictured above. The item weighs approximately 10 lbs.
Only 1,000 of this special edition statue was made worldwide, and it was previously only available through Best Comics in New York.
